What Science is Saying About Nutrition and Mental Health
A growing body of research emphasizes the vital role of nutrition in maintaining physical and mental health. The World Health Organization's (WHO) initiatives underline that a balanced and varied diet rich in essential nutrients significantly impacts disease prevention. While nutrition has been widely recognized as crucial for physical well-being, its influence on mental health disorders, particularly in children and adolescents, is a more complex area of study that requires further exploration.
One of the pressing concerns in developed countries is the rising prevalence of mental health issues. These conditions are often exacerbated by poor diet, particularly diets high in processed foods laden with trans fats and low in essential vitamins and minerals. The WHO highlights the need to reduce the intake of harmful substances such as sodium and industrially produced trans fats, aiming to promote overall well-being and longevity.
The intersection of diet and mental health has become a controversial topic within the scientific community. There is an ongoing debate regarding how dietary modifications can influence the onset and progression of mental health disorders. This gap in understanding underscores the need for more cohesive treatment strategies that incorporate diet as a fundamental component of holistic mental health interventions.
Diet Intervention on ADHD
Attention-deficit/hyperactivity disorder (ADHD) exemplifies how nutrition can impact mental health. ADHD is a chronic neurodevelopmental disorder affecting about 6% of children worldwide and persists into adulthood for a significant portion of those diagnosed. It is associated with a wide array of harmful consequences, including impaired academic performance, heightened risk of social isolation, aggressive behavior, and an increased risk of premature death due to accidents.
Standard interventions for ADHD typically involve a combination of pharmacological treatment, primarily psychostimulants, and psychological therapies. While short-term efficacy in alleviating acute ADHD symptoms is well-documented, long-term outcomes are less satisfactory, with many patients continuing to experience symptoms despite treatment. This reality has led researchers to explore alternative and complementary interventions, particularly nutritional strategies, to address underlying triggers and improve symptom management.
Recent studies suggest that diet plays a significant role in ADHD management. Deficiencies in specific nutrients can exacerbate symptoms such as inattention, hyperactivity, and impulsivity. Conversely, well-structured diets that include adequate levels of vitamins, minerals, and essential fatty acids may enhance cognitive function and mitigate these symptoms. Research focusing on micronutrients like iron and zinc has revealed promising results, indicating that supplementation could play a role in ADHD treatment.
A systematic review conducted by Granero and colleagues sheds light on the benefits of dietary interventions, particularly regarding zinc and iron supplementation. Their analysis of randomized trials over the past two decades shows that lower baseline levels of these minerals in ADHD patients can correlate with more pronounced symptoms. Furthermore, their findings emphasize that tailored diet interventions might yield varying benefits depending on individual patients' specific profiles and needs.
The Importance of Targeted Nutritional Interventions
The evidence suggests that integrating dietary interventions into existing treatment plans can enhance treatment efficacy for ADHD and potentially other mental health disorders. By focusing on nutritional strategies, healthcare providers could address modifiable risk factors that contribute to poor mental health outcomes. Moreover, such interventions could also align with broader public health initiatives aimed at reducing the incidence of mental health disorders in populations at risk.
Researchers advocate for a holistic approach, where nutrition and lifestyle changes complement pharmacological and psychological treatments. This strategy acknowledges the complex interplay between diet, mental health, and overall well-being, reinforcing the idea that improved mental health could stem from a multifaceted treatment perspective.
